earlier than India feminine footballer On Thursday, a file will likely be handed over to every participant on board the flight from Kochi to Mumbai. From primary COVID-appropriate habits to avoiding outlets and cafes on the airport, the doc will element the do’s and don’ts for his or her journey.

And as quickly as they land in Mumbai, the 23-member squad and training employees will likely be separated from different passengers and brought to a devoted testing space on the arrival terminal by way of particular lanes. Only after testing damaging will the gamers board the bus for his or her hourly journey to Navi Mumbai, the place they are going to be in a bio-secure setting for the following fortnight.

Mumbai was reporting the very best variety of instances of any metropolis within the nation until a number of days in the past, however now the expansion is exhibiting clear indicators of stabilisation. On Tuesday, town reported solely 11,647 new instances, nearly half of what was reported a number of days in the past.

But Maharashtra shouldn’t be taking any possibilities. The state authorities is making each effort to make sure that the Asian Cup, which begins on January 20, shouldn’t be derailed by the third wave. The 12-nation event, which can also be a qualifier for the 2023 Women’s World Cup, will likely be performed behind closed doorways in Pune, Navi Mumbai and Mumbai.

According to Aaditya Thackeray, minister of state and president of the Mumbai District Football Association, gamers and officers “will be in a bio-bubble and set testing protocols for their own safety”.

“The most stringent COVID-appropriate behavioral protocols have been put in place to ensure that all teams, officers and support staff are safe inside the bubble, and to protect our citizens,” Thackeray instructed The Indian Express. “We are sure that the tournament will be a great success, although without spectators and fans at the moment.”

India’s sports activities calendar has already been hit by the newest Covid surge.

On Monday, the cricket board was pressured to postpone the knockout matches of the Under-19 Cooch Behar Trophy in Pune. Earlier, the All India Football Federation needed to droop the I-League, the nation’s second-tier soccer championship to be held in Kolkata.

The ongoing Indian Super League in Goa has additionally reported Covid instances, whereas the India Open Badminton Championship, which acquired underway in New Delhi on Tuesday, made a last-minute return after some high gamers examined constructive.

But the organizers of the Asian Cup are assured in regards to the course of.

276 soccer gamers, and a whole lot of coaches, match officers and organisers, can have devoted, fast-paced immigration lanes on the Mumbai airport, frequent RT-PCR exams and fully remoted from the native inhabitants in the course of the event, which ends . on 6 February

Tournament officers stated the touring groups and the Asian Football Confederation (AFC) had expressed considerations in regards to the state-mandated seven-day institutional quarantine for worldwide vacationers.

“However, the central and state governments gave an exemption as the tournament is being conducted in a bio-bubble, where everyone will be practically in a quarantine-like condition. That assurance was very comforting,” stated an official.

The official additionally stated that elaborate procedures have been put in place to attenuate the interplay of visiting groups with the native inhabitants, proper from the time they land. Three international locations – Australia, China and Iran – will take chartered flights to Mumbai, whereas the remaining will take business flights by way of Doha or Dubai.

“At the airport, even before they leave for immigration, we have set up a dedicated testing facility for the visiting teams and officials. Once they clear it, they will be escorted by the organizing committee staff to dedicated immigration counters and there will be a separate lane for them to exit the terminal,” the official stated.

The groups are being saved in seven inns in Navi Mumbai and Pune, which will likely be completely for his or her use. Hotel employees, drivers, cooks and different attendants may also be part of the bio-bubble. Teams and officers will solely be allowed to journey between the resort and the venue and will likely be examined each 72 hours.

The event will start on January 20 with a match between China and Chinese Taipei on the Mumbai Football Arena. Coached by Sweden’s Thomas Dennerby, India will open their marketing campaign in opposition to Iran on the DY Patil Stadium later that day.
